Consider yourself warned if you decide to take up employment as an ALT with this company based in Kitakyushu, Japan. This is not a whine and gripe posting, but based on facts and hard-learned lessons. In short, OWLS is routinely and knowingly violating Japanese Labour Law and Labour Standards when it comes to its ALTs. If you do decide to work for this company, I would strongly suggest joining the Fukuoka General Union to protect yourself, as the company doesn't seem too concerned with its employees' rights under the law.
They have misinformed, misrepresented information, or broken labour laws and standards concerning the following issues: paid holidays, withholding final pay, health insurance options, fines for contract cancellation, company arranged apartment expenses, non-renewal of contracts, and no salary for the month of August.

Thanks for your post Genke. If only more would speak out maybe we could help some people avoid this lot like the plague!

Unfortunately I have had the unplesant experience of being employed by OWLS.

In addition to the above post.

Bait and switch. 3 months contracts for those with the Onojo BOE in & around Fukuoka City. No health insurance.

Depending on amount of days in the month, pay as low as 180,000 yen. Not 250,000 yen as advertised.

Sick days/leave? see recent Interac threads regarding deceased child. Same old story, different dispatch company. They will also fire you for being ill (perhaps a blessing). They demand 1 weeks notice in regards to illness Rolling Eyes

Transportation expenses as low as 10,000 yen limit per month. There is no limit though from the BOE who pay for this. OWLS take the difference. http://yearofthedog.wordpress.com/2008/ ... -for-owls/

Try to make you sign an illegal agreement saying they get $1200 if you break your contract.

It goes on and on. Shame.
